Celebrating our collections department supervisor Eric Ruiz’s 35th Anniversary at NHSA!

We are thrilled to celebrate a significant milestone at North Hudson Sewerage Authority (NHSA) – Eric Ruiz’s 35th Anniversary with our organization. For over three decades, Eric has been an invaluable member of our team, dedicating his career as collections department supervisor to ensuring the efficient and effective treatment of wastewater for our community.

Eric joined NHSA 35 years ago, bringing with him a passion and a commitment to public health. Over the years, he has played a pivotal role in various projects and initiatives that have enhanced our wastewater treatment processes and infrastructure. His wealth of knowledge and experience has been instrumental in navigating the challenges of wastewater management and in driving our mission forward.
